American football player, NFL linebacker
Professionally played football as a linebacker in the National Football League (NFL). Started the career with the Arizona Cardinals, contributing to the team’s defensive strategies. Played a key role in the Cardinals' appearance in Super Bowl XLIII. Continued the career with teams including the Miami Dolphins and the Cleveland Browns, demonstrating consistent performance. Accumulated several career statistics, including tackles and sacks, showcasing expertise in defensive positions throughout over a decade of participation in the league.
Participated in Super Bowl XLIII with the Arizona Cardinals
Achieved over 1,000 career tackles

Continue ReadingScottish chemist and physician contributed significantly to the field of chemistry. Educated at the University of Edinburgh, conducted pioneering work on gases and identified nitrogen as a distinct element in 1772. His research laid the groundwork for modern chemical analysis and the study of gases. He also served as a Royal Physician in Edinburgh and held various academic positions throughout his career. Published research findings that advanced the understanding of atmospheric gases and their properties.

Continue ReadingBorn in 1659, played a significant role in the Joseon Dynasty as a royal consort to King Sukjong. She was highly influential in the court and her political maneuvers shaped the dynamics of the royal family during her time. Jang's impact extended beyond her marriage, as she was involved in various court intrigues and was pivotal in the succession of her son, later known as King Gyeongjong. Her tenure was marked by the complexities of palace life and the relationships among the various factions vying for power. Jang's legacy is remembered through historical texts that detail her life and the social structures of the Joseon period.
